Syngenta’s seed and pesticide portfolio opens up new perspectives
Syngenta’s market-leading sunflower portfolio is expanding with new hybrids, but new products capable of serious performance in rapeseed, cereals and maize have made their debut at traditional ser-show events in Pápa and Hajdúböszörmény. The company’s varieties are helped by a new generation of plant protection solutions on the road to abundant crops.
